From Darkness to Daylight: A Journey of Addiction and Recovery
Smith's early years were marked by a brutal battle with addiction. Cocaine, OxyContin, and alcohol cast a long shadow, leading to a 70-pound weight gain and a profound sense of despair. This wasn't just a personal struggle; it threatened to derail his career and his life. However, this adversity, rather than breaking him, fueled his determination to overcome. He channeled his pain and struggles into his music, finding a powerful outlet for his emotions. "The music became my therapy," he might say, paraphrasing his own words. Shinedown's Ascent: A Symphony of Success
Smith's financial success is irrevocably linked to Shinedown's meteoric rise. The band's more than 10 million album sales are a testament to their enduring appeal, a major contributor to Smith's net worth. But sheer sales figures only tell part of the story. Smart strategic moves, a strong record deal with Atlantic Records, and relentless touring solidified their position. Shinedown cultivated a fiercely loyal fanbase, built on the foundation of exceptional music and electrifying live performances. The Turning Point: Fatherhood and a New Dawn
Fatherhood proved to be a pivotal turning point in Smith’s life. The responsibility and love he discovered ignited a profound desire for change. He embarked on a rigorous path toward sobriety, actively seeking professional help and building a strong support system. This wasn't just about physical health; it was a complete overhaul of his life’s priorities. The weight loss, a tangible symbol of his renewed commitment to well-being, mirrored the deeper transformation taking place within. How impactful was this change in his life?
